Intergenerational Collaboration in Philanthropy

24 January 2025 - 17:00 - 18:00 UTC0

Organised by YouthxYouth

Moderated by Nathan from Porticus, Hosted by Erioluwa from YouthxYouth and featuring panelists, Remijus from Global Fund for Children and Gayle from Little Big Fund this session will explore the question of how funders are collaborating with youth leaders and their communities to create meaningful, lasting change.

Throughout this discussion, we aim to explore several thought-provoking questions, including:
What if young people were at the center of philanthropic decisions? What would that look, smell, and feel like?
How can we disrupt the “adultification” of funding, where young people are expected to conform to adult standards or navigate inaccessible opportunities to build relationships with funders?
What would it mean if funders and donors saw themselves as allies, not just partners, in the work of transformation?

By the end of the session, we hope to inspire concrete commitments, including:
A stronger commitment from funders to engage in intergenerational collaboration.
A pledge to be more inclusive of young people in decision-making processes.
A shift towards intergenerational ways of working in philanthropy.
